# Norepinephrine (Noradrenaline)
## Overview
Norepinephrine is a potent catecholamine with primary alpha-1 agonist activity resulting in profound peripheral vasoconstriction and moderate beta-1 agonist activity leading to increased inotropy. It is the first-line vasopressor for septic shock.
## Primary Indications
* Acute hypotensive states (e.g., septic, cardiogenic, or neurogenic shock)
* Adjunct treatment during cardiac arrest (though epinephrine is preferred)
## Adult Dosing
* **Initial Infusion:** 0.01 to 0.05 mcg/kg/min or 2–4 mcg/min (fixed rate).
* **Titration:** Titrate to target Mean Arterial Pressure (MAP) (typically ≥65 mmHg). Usual maintenance range is 0.05–0.5 mcg/kg/min, though refractory cases may require >1 mcg/kg/min.
* **Maximum:** No strict pharmacologic maximum; however, escalating doses reflect severe underlying pathology/refractory shock. High doses (e.g., >1 mcg/kg/min) are associated with severe peripheral ischemia.
## Pediatric Dosing
* **Continuous Infusion:** 0.05 to 0.1 mcg/kg/min.
* **Titration:** Titrate by 0.05 mcg/kg/min every 5–10 minutes based on perfusion and blood pressure goals.
* **Maximum:** Up to 1–2 mcg/kg/min in pediatric intensive care under strict hemodynamic monitoring.
## Dose Adjustments
* **Hepatic/Renal Impairment:** No standard dosage adjustments provided in labeling; monitor hemodynamic response closely.
* **Older Adults:** Use caution; may be more sensitive to vasoconstrictive effects.
## Contraindications
* None in emergency/crisis settings. Use with extreme caution in patients with peripheral vascular thrombosis or mesenteric/peripheral vascular ischemia.
## Adverse Effects
* **Common:** Hypertension, tachycardia, arrhythmias.
* **Severe:** Extravasation causing tissue necrosis (sloughing), limb ischemia, mesenteric ischemia, anxiety, headache.
## Key Drug Interactions
* **MAO Inhibitors / TCAs:** May cause severe, prolonged hypertension.
* **Beta-Blockers (Non-selective):** May lead to unopposed alpha-mediated vasoconstriction (severe hypertension and reflex bradycardia).
* **Halogenated Hydrocarbons (e.g., anesthetics):** Increased risk of arrhythmias.
## Monitoring
* **Continuous:** Continuous intra-arterial blood pressure monitoring (preferred for titration).
* **Safety:** Examine infusion site frequently for extravasation (sign: blanching/cold skin).
* **Clinical:** Heart rate, rhythm (ECG), urine output, peripheral perfusion/capillary refill, and serum lactate levels.
## Clinical Pearls
* **Extravasation Management:** If extravasation occurs, stop the infusion immediately and infiltrate the area with **phentolamine** (alpha-antagonist) per institutional protocol.
* **Central Line:** Preferred route for administration to avoid extravasation; can be used in a large peripheral vein temporarily if necessary, but transition to central access promptly.
* **Volume Status:** Norepinephrine is ineffective in hypovolemic patients; ensure adequate fluid resuscitation prior to or concurrent with initiation.
* **Institutional Protocol:** Always consult your facility's specific drug infusion guidelines, as concentrations (dilutions) and titration schedules vary by hospital policy.
